1. Switch to Renewable Energy at Home

Think about this: every time you flip a light switch or turn on your coffee maker, you're using energy. If that energy comes from fossil fuels like coal or gas, it's contributing to global warming.

But there's a better way. Today, many utility companies give you the option to buy clean, renewable energy—like solar or wind power—instead of electricity from dirty sources. And if you own your home, installing solar panels is now more affordable than ever. In some areas, you can even get tax breaks or government incentives to help cover the cost.

Easy tips to save energy:

  • Use LED bulbs instead of traditional ones—they use a fraction of the power.
  • Seal gaps in windows and doors to keep warm or cool air inside.
  • Unplug devices when not in use (yes, that phone charger pulls power even when it’s not charging anything!).

Even small changes in your energy habits can lead to big savings and a lower carbon footprint.

2. Eat More Plants and Less Meat

Did you know that food—especially meat and dairy—accounts for a large chunk of global greenhouse gas emissions? That’s because raising livestock takes a huge amount of land, water, and feed—not to mention the methane (a powerful greenhouse gas) cows release.

Here’s the good news: you don’t need to go full vegan to help. Even just cutting back on beef and replacing it with plant-based meals a few times a week makes a difference.

Try this:

  • Meatless Mondays: Make one day a week 100% plant-based.
  • Eat local and seasonal foods: They travel less and are often fresher.
  • Find alternatives: Lentils, beans, tofu, and quinoa can be just as hearty and delicious as meat-centered meals.

3. Choose Eco-Friendly Transportation

Think about your daily commute—are you sitting in traffic burning gas? Cars, trucks, planes—they’re all major contributors to greenhouse gas emissions.

Fortunately, there are tons of options that are better for the environment (and often for your health). Getting around in greener ways is one of the quickest ways to slash your carbon footprint.

Try some of these:

  • Walk or bike for short trips—it’s free exercise, too!
  • Use public transportation or carpool when driving is needed.
  • Switch to an electric vehicle (EV) if you’re in the market for a new car—there are more EV models than ever before.
  • Fly less, and when you do, consider carbon offset programs offered by airlines.

Even if you just replace one car trip a week with walking or biking, that’s one less bit of emissions being pumped into the air—and that’s something to be proud of.

4. Make Your Home More Energy Efficient

Your home may feel cozy and efficient, but chances are, it has room for improvement. Many homes lose energy because they’re not well insulated or rely on outdated systems to stay warm or cool.

Here’s what you can do:

  • Use cold water to wash your clothes—it cleans just as well and uses less energy.
  • Air-dry clothes on a rack or clothesline instead of using the dryer.
  • Add insulation to your attic or walls to keep heat in during winter and out in the summer.
  • Consider heat pumps as replacements for old oil or gas heating systems—they’re highly efficient and eco-friendly.

Many of these upgrades also qualify for rebates or incentives depending on where you live. So not only does an energy-efficient home help the environment, but it can lower your energy bills too.

5. Get Involved in Local Climate Action

Yes, individual choices matter—but when we come together, we’re even stronger.

There are people in every city, town, and village working hard to build more resilient, sustainable communities. Get connected, and you’ll be amazed at the difference you can make when you team up with others.

Ways to make an impact:

  • Join or support local tree planting events or community gardens.
  • Volunteer for clean-up activities in parks, beaches, or neighborhoods.
  • Attend town hall meetings and advocate for clean energy and green infrastructure.
  • Talk to friends and family about climate change—spreading awareness is powerful!
